Why this job matters

The PPC & Affiliates Manager is responsible for delivering significant business growth through expert management of paid search and affiliate marketing channels. By combining advanced technical knowledge, commercial acumen, and strong leadership, this role ensures campaigns are optimised for maximum efficiency and impact. The manager drives innovation, manages budgets, and collaborates with internal and external partners to achieve ambitious performance targets and support the overall growth strategy.

What you’ll be doing

  • Lead the planning, execution, and optimisation of PPC campaigns (Google Ads, Microsoft Ads, etc.) and affiliate programmes, ensuring alignment with business goals.
  • Manage budgets, bids, and performance analytics to maximise ROI, efficiency, and incremental growth.
  • Oversee keyword strategy, ad copy, landing page optimisation, and affiliate partner recruitment and management.
  • Diagnose and resolve campaign issues, identifying opportunities for improvement and innovation.
  • Collaborate with finance, analytics, and performance teams to ensure accurate forecasting, reporting, and budget control.
  • Ensure compliance with platform policies, data privacy, and affiliate best practices.
  • Provide guidance and support to cross-functional teams, sharing expertise and driving adoption of best practices.
  • Monitor industry trends, competitor activity, and platform updates to maintain a leading edge in PPC and affiliate marketing.

Skills required for the job

  • Advanced expertise in paid search marketing (Google Ads, Microsoft Ads) and affiliate marketing ecosystems.
  • Strong analytical skills for campaign analysis, bid management, and ROI optimisation.
  • In-depth understanding of attribution, tracking, and compliance (e.g., GDPR, platform policies).
  • Commercial awareness and experience negotiating with networks, publishers, and partners.
  • Excellent communication and collaboration skills for working with agencies, finance, analytics, and senior stakeholders.
  • Organisational skills to manage multiple campaigns, budgets, and reporting requirements.
  • Leadership qualities to influence and guide teams, even without direct line management.
  • Adaptability and a proactive approach to testing, learning, and implementing new strategies.

Experience you would be expected to have

  • Demonstrated experience in PPC and affiliate marketing, including hands-on campaign management and optimisation.
  • Proven track record of achieving and exceeding performance targets in a fast-paced environment.
  • Experience with budget management, forecasting, and financial reporting for marketing activities.
  • Background in negotiating with affiliate networks, publishers, and partners.
  • Exposure to working with cross-functional teams (e.g., analytics, finance, creative) to deliver integrated campaigns.
  • Familiarity with compliance, tracking, and platform standards affecting campaign delivery.
  • Experience supporting or leading transformation initiatives or process improvements in digital marketing.
